Slick 3.0记录查询性能

时间:2015-06-16 16:42:13

标签: slick slick-3.0

目前我已启用DEBUG登录:

slick.backend

它记录事务开始/结束,由slick运行的已编译的sql查询以及success / results。

可以为我提供有关查询运行时间的信息吗?我应该在哪个软件包上启用DEBUG模式,以获取此信息?

修改

我发现这个link谈论这不可能。这仍然适用吗?

1 个答案:

答案 0 :(得分:9)

在@szeiger的帮助下找到问题的答案。启用日志记录以获取有关在Slick 3.0中执行SQL查询的计时信息:

slick.jdbc.JdbcBackend.benchmark

启用DEBUG登录的其他有用软件包:

slick.jdbc.JdbcBackend.statement
slick.jdbc.StatementInvoker.result
slick.compiler.QueryCompilerBenchmark

*Reference:*
https://github.com/slick/slick/blob/master/common-test-resources/logback.xml